A colonoscopy isn't just a test for bowel cancer, it's one of the most effective ways to investigate ongoing digestive symptoms.

Changes in bowel habits, bleeding, unexplained abdominal pain, or persistent diarrhoea are all reasons your doctor may recommend one. During the procedure, polyps can often be removed before they may develop into something more serious.

Many digestive conditions can't be diagnosed through symptoms alone.

A colonoscopy or gastroscopy allows specialists to see what's happening inside your digestive tract and bowel, helping identify the cause of symptoms and guide the right treatment.

These investigations can detect everything from inflammation and ulcers to polyps and early signs of bowel cancer. Our experienced endoscopy specialists at Intus provide timely access to these important procedures, helping patients get answers sooner.

Endoscopy procedures such as colonoscopy and gastroscopy aren’t just about diagnosing problems, they can also help prevent them.

During a colonoscopy, specialists can identify and remove polyps that may develop into bowel cancer. A gastroscopy can help detect and assess conditions affecting the oesophagus and stomach, including reflux and ulcers.

Early investigation gives patients clarity, peace of mind, and the opportunity to address issues before they become more serious.
